在当今数字经济的快速发展下,虚拟货币的使用逐渐深入到各个领域。随着越来越多的人投资数字资产,保护这些资产的安全性也变得尤为重要。冷钱包,作为一种有效的资产保护工具,近年来备受关注。本文将深入探讨虚拟币冷钱包的开发原理、技术架构以及如何有效提高数字资产的安全性,并在此基础上回答一些常见的问题。本文将围绕“虚拟币冷钱包开发”这一主题展开详细阐述。

                  一、什么是虚拟币冷钱包?

                  冷钱包是一种能够离线存储数字货币的设备或软件,主要用于保护用户的加密货币资产。与热钱包(即在线钱包)相对,冷钱包通过完全不与互联网连接,极大降低了被黑客攻击的风险。冷钱包通常用于长期储存虚拟货币,适合那些不需要频繁交易的用户。

                  虚拟币冷钱包的发展源自于对加密货币安全性的关注。冷钱包可以采用硬件设备、纸质钱包以及一些特殊的离线软件等形式。硬件冷钱包是一种物理设备,用户可以将其直接连接到计算机上进行交易;纸质钱包则是将私钥打印在纸上进行存储;而离线软件钱包则是通过在未连接网络的环境中进行生成和存储。

                  二、冷钱包的开发原理

                  虚拟币冷钱包开发:保护你的数字资产安全性指南

                  开发一款虚拟币冷钱包主要分为以下几个步骤:

                  1. 需求分析与设计:在开发初期,开发者需明确用户需求,包括支持的虚拟币种类、用户体验和安全性等方面的要求。
                  2. 技术选型:选择开发冷钱包的技术栈,包括编程语言(如C 、Python等)、数据库技术(如SQLite等)以及加密算法(如SHA-256、ECDSA等)。
                  3. 安全机制的实现:实施多种安全机制,如双重身份验证、加密存储、保护私钥等,以防止潜在的安全威胁。
                  4. 界面开发:开发友好的用户界面,使用户能够方便地进行虚拟货币的管理和操作。
                  5. 测试与:完成开发后进行多轮测试,发现并修复潜在的bug。同时,根据测试结果进行性能,提升用户体验。
                  6. 上线和维护:在确认软件稳定和安全性后进行正式上线,并为用户提供后续的技术支持和更新迭代。

                  三、冷钱包的安全性特点

                  冷钱包的安全性体现在多个方面:

                  • 离线存储:冷钱包在设计上不和互联网连接,极大减少了黑客攻击的可能性,大幅提升了安全性。
                  • 加密技术:冷钱包采用先进的加密技术,对用户的私钥及敏感信息进行层层保护,确保数据不被盗取。
                  • 物理安全:硬件冷钱包一般都有防盗设计,比如防拆卸、密封等,物理破坏难度高,保障了资产的安全。

                  除此之外,通过定期更新软件版本、修复潜在漏洞等方式,可以进一步提高冷钱包的安全性。

                  四、虚拟币冷钱包开发的挑战

                  虚拟币冷钱包开发:保护你的数字资产安全性指南

                  尽管冷钱包的开发可以为用户提供更高的安全性,但在开发过程中也会面临不少挑战:

                  • 用户体验:对于非技术用户来说,冷钱包的使用可能会较为复杂,开发者需要不断用户界面和使用流程。
                  • 兼容性:支持多种虚拟币的冷钱包可能需要考虑不同加密算法和协议,增加了开发的复杂性。
                  • 安全性与便利性的平衡:在确保安全的同时,如何不影响用户的便捷操作是开发者需要重点考虑的问题。

                  相关问题及详细解答

                  1. 冷钱包与热钱包有什么区别?

                  在讨论虚拟币的存储时,冷钱包与热钱包是两个基础概念。热钱包通常指的是在线钱包,它们保存在互联网上,适合频繁交易。而冷钱包则是离线的数字资产存储方案。

                  首先,安全性是二者最大区别。热钱包因其与网络的紧密联系,容易成为黑客攻击的目标,虽然操作便利却容易导致资产风险增加。冷钱包则因其不与网络连接,风险较小。然而,冷钱包在使用时不如热钱包方便,因其需要额外的操作,比如将冷钱包连接到电脑进行交易等。

                  其次,使用场景也有所不同。热钱包更适合日常小额交易、频繁使用的场景,而冷钱包更适合于长期存储大额资产。用户的需求决定了选择热钱包还是冷钱包。对于投资者来说,理想的方式是结合二者的优点,采用合理的资产管理策略。

                  2. 如何选择合适的冷钱包?

                  选择合适的冷钱包对保护数字资产至关重要。首先需要考虑的是钱包的安全性。选择市场上信誉良好、具有先进加密技术的冷钱包可以为用户提供更高的安全保障。

                  其次,要考虑冷钱包的用户体验。用户界面友好、操作简单的冷钱包能够让初学者更快上手,一些品牌还提供售后服务和技术支持,这也是值得关注的因素。

                  最后,确保冷钱包支持你所持有的虚拟货币种类。一些冷钱包可能仅限于某几种主流币种,而其他冷钱包则支持多种不同的数字货币。因此,根据自己的投资种类,选择适合的冷钱包。

                  3. 使用冷钱包存储虚拟币有哪些注意事项?

                  首先,确保冷钱包设备或纸质钱包的物理安全,不要将其随意放置在陌生或公共场所。

                  其次,在保存私钥和恢复种子时,务必注意不要泄露给他人。将他们记录在一个安全的地方,并备份重要信息避免遗失。

                  还应定期更新冷钱包软件,以防止安全漏洞,同时了解最新的安全协议和实践,确保资产始终得到保护。

                  4. 冷钱包的未来发展趋势?

                  随着虚拟货币市场的不断演进,冷钱包的未来发展呈现出以下趋势:

                  • 更强的安全性:随着网络攻击技术的提高,冷钱包将不断升级安全防护措施,例如引入生物识别技术、硬件加密等。
                  • 用户体验:未来冷钱包的界面将更直观、操作更便捷,以吸引更多的普通用户。
                  • 多币种支持:冷钱包将逐渐支持更广泛的虚拟货币,以满足不同投资者的需求。

                  综上所述,虚拟币冷钱包的开发不仅提供了安全存储数字资产的解决方案,也面临挑战和机遇。理解冷钱包的运作机制,选择合适的冷钱包,以及注意存储方式,都是保护数字资产的重要环节。随着技术的持续进步,冷钱包的安全性和用户友好性将进一步提升,成为数字货币管理的重要工具。